"My mother was in a wonderful community called Sage Living. I was a little worried when she was in there because she was a widow, but I would see people walking around with their yoga mats and heading over to yoga class, and the food was wonderful, so it completely erased my fears about those things. The staff was just so friendly and nice. She had a stroke and had to go into memory care, and I cannot say enough nice things about the staff. My husband and I, when we work in Wyoming in the summer, still take gifts to the staff there because they were so wonderful. It's also a small town, and you run into each other. Even my sisters cannot say enough good things about the place. My husband and sisters would all agree with me. We all stop by and say hi to them because they were so patient and kind to my mother. The local artists donated art to decorate the facility. The local high school comes and plants gardens where the residents can walk and sit on benches and get some sunshine. They have wonderful options when it comes to activities. The thing that impacted my mother so much was that after the stroke, she wasn't able to string together a sentence or a question. She would try, but she had lost her ability to speak much. But there was music therapy there twice a week, where a local guitarist would come in. She would pick songs that were of the generation of the people that lived there, and my mom could sing every word, and she would just come alive and smile. We always made it for that and sat with her. She would play the drum on my husband's head just to have fun. I can't go in comparison to other places, but I would say she had the best care there ever."
